The way of life in the countryside, as opposed to life in the city, often perceived as quieter and closer to nature.
example
Nach vielen Jahren in der Großstadt sehnte sie sich nach dem ruhigen Landleben.
After many years in the big city, she longed for quiet country life.
Usage tips
Compound word
This word is made up of 'Land' (in the sense of 'rural area') and 'Leben' (life). So it literally describes 'Leben auf dem Land' (life in the countryside).
EXAMPLE
Für viele Menschen ist das Landleben eine attraktive Alternative zur Hektik der Stadt.
For many people, country life is an attractive alternative to the hectic pace of the city.
Typical collocations
'Landleben' (country life) is often combined with verbs that express a positive experience or a wish, such as 'das Landleben genießen' (to enjoy country life), 'das Landleben lieben' (to love country life), or 'sich nach dem Landleben sehnen' (to long for country life).
EXAMPLE
Am Wochenende fahren wir oft aufs Land, um das einfache Landleben zu genießen.
On weekends, we often go to the countryside to enjoy simple country life.
Positive meaning
The word often has a positive and sometimes romanticizing meaning. It is frequently associated with peace and quiet, nature, and a less hectic pace.
EXAMPLE
Sie träumt von einem idyllischen Landleben mit einem großen Garten.
She dreams of an idyllic country life with a large garden.
